Typical Signs of Dampness in a Structure



Dampness concerns within a building can manifest with numerous obvious indicators that suggest the presence of moisture. One prominent indicator is the appearance of water discolorations on ceilings or wall surfaces, which typically suggests wetness infiltration. Additionally, gurgling or peeling paint can recommend that excess humidity is caught beneath the surface area, leading to deterioration. One more common indicator is the visibility of mold and mold, which prosper in moist problems and can frequently be recognized by their stuffy odor. A surge in moisture levels can cause condensation on windows and various other surfaces, highlighting dampness troubles. Finally, deformed or unequal floor covering might signal underlying moisture that compromises structural honesty. Recognizing these signs early can assist reduce possible damages and keep a risk-free living environment. Normal evaluations and prompt action are important in resolving dampness problems before they intensify.

Different Sorts Of Damp Proofing Solutions



Numerous aspects can contribute to damp issues in buildings, picking the appropriate damp proofing solution is important for protecting structural stability. Several options are offered, each customized to specific conditions.One usual option is a damp-proof membrane (DPM), commonly made from polyethylene or bitumen, which is installed in floors and wall surfaces to avoid moisture ingress. One more option is damp-proof courses (DPC), which are layers of waterproof material placed within wall surfaces to obstruct increasing damp.Chemical damp proofing involves infusing waterproofing chemicals right into wall surfaces to develop an obstacle against moisture. Furthermore, external therapies such as tanking, which involves using a waterproof layer to the beyond foundations, can be reliable in stopping water penetration.Each solution has its advantages and is picked based upon the building's specific issues, environmental problems, and lasting upkeep factors to consider, making sure perfect security versus damp-related damages.

Choosing the Right Damp Proofing Approach for Your Property



Which damp proofing method is most suitable for a specific residential property typically relies on different factors, consisting of the building's age, existing moisture problems, and local environmental conditions. For older frameworks, typical methods such as asphalt membranes or cementitious coatings might be a lot more effective, as they can give a robust barrier against climbing damp. In comparison, more recent structures could profit from modern-day options like injected damp-proof courses, which are less invasive and can be customized to details moisture challenges.Additionally, residential properties in areas with high water tables or hefty rains might need advanced techniques, such as cavity wall surface drain systems or external waterproofing. Homeowners ought to also consider the certain materials utilized in their building's building, as some techniques might not be compatible. Ultimately, a detailed assessment by a specialist can guide building owners in selecting the most reliable moist proofing approach customized to their distinct conditions.
